School scale

964 students

SPRING MILLS MIDDLE SCHOOL reports 964 students, larger than most same-level county peers. Among 5 other middle schools in Berkeley County with enrollment data, 5 report fewer students and 0 report more. The peer median is 673 students.

County peer set

6 middle schools

The same-level county median enrollment is 706 students. Use it to separate unusually small or large schools from typical peers.

District path

32 district schools

BERKELEY COUNTY SCHOOLS lists 21 primary, 6 middle, 4 high, 1 other schools in the current NCES data. For a middle-school choice, confirm which high school students usually continue to and whether program eligibility changes by address.
